Loosely associated statements refer to a set of ideas or claims that are not directly connected or tightly linked to one another. Each statement may relate to a common theme or subject but lacks a clear logical relationship or coherence that would bring them together in a more structured argument or narrative. In practice, loosely associated statements might be used in discussions, brainstorming sessions, or informal conversations where ideas are shared in a more free-flowing manner.
